Perfect Square
51710189659969434157190299770779487626772512089 is a perfect square (227398745950740533447717 × 227398745950740533447717)
51710189659969434157190299770779487626772512089 is a perfect square (227398745950740533447717 × 227398745950740533447717)
51710189659969434157190299770779487626772512089 is odd
Previous odd number is 51710189659969434157190299770779487626772512087
Next odd number is 51710189659969434157190299770779487626772512091
1001 0000 1110 1100 0011 1101 1101 1001 0000 0010 0111 1101 0101 1100 0111 1001 1111 1100 1010 1101 0101 0000 1010 0010 0111 0110 1100 0000 0010 1011 1000 1010 0010 0011 1110 0111 1101 0101 1001
138270136625669398929477939442335992559277582458477178323069023787790449563716397708770362700607194910196344742102565421041516473691651360969
2673943714670009784542386241989270329739262837983583582610336958692009282165218596355651143921